Arsenal face a crucial fixture in their Premier League title bid with Mikel Areta's side having the chance to increase their lead before Manchester City play next

Arsenal host Bournemouth at home on Saturday with the chance to move 12 points clear at the top with a win. The Gunners play more than 24 hours before Manchester City kick off at Chelsea on Sunday afternoon.

Mikel Arteta's team return to action after Tuesday's crucial 1-0 win at Sporting in the Champions League with the second-leg in north London on Wednesday night. But attention will be on this weekend's clash against the Cherries before next weekend's crucial clash at title rivals City.

And Arteta has several injury concerns within his squad ahead of a busy few weeks. Below is the latest Arsenal injury news as well as updates from Arteta...

Bukayo Saka

Bukayo Saka, Martin Odegaard, Piero Hincapie, Riccardo Calafiori and Jurrien Timber all missed Thursday's session on the grass due to various fitness problems.

When asked if any of them could return this weekend, Arteta said: "Yes, there have been changes there since yesterday."

He was then pushed on who might be back, to which he replied: "I don't know. Some of them."

Possible return date: Bournemouth (H) Saturday, April 11

Martin Odegaard

Odegaard was forced off in the second half in Portugal with an unspecified issue and Norway boss Stale Solbakken later confirmed that the 27-year-old had suffered a small injury setback.

He said: "He got a little one [injury] where he shouldn’t have, but I don’t think it’s anything serious. He’ll be on the field in the near future. It was a small setback, and we don’t need any more of them."

Possible return date: Bournemouth (H) Saturday, April 11

Piero Hincapie

Hincapie played for Ecuador in the two-week domestic break but hobbled off during one of their games, with Arteta confirming he does indeed have an issue.

Possible return date: Bournemouth (H) Saturday, April 11

Jurrien Timber

Right-back Timber has been nursing a groin issue since starting the 2-0 win over Everton one month ago, when he was substituted before the half-time interval.

Possible return date: Bournemouth (H) Saturday, April 11

Eberechi Eze

A calf problem has kept Eze out for three weeks, but Arteta has confirmed that he is available against Bournemouth.

What Arteta has said: "He is available. My first conversation with him after felt that niggle he wanted to be available the next week. That was not possible. The recovery, the way he has shown to get back, the way he has pushed."

Return date: Bournemouth (H) Saturday, April 11

Mikel Merino

Merino has missed the last few months after undergoing foot surgery. He is recovering well and was spotted in a protective boot at the Carabao Cup final with the aim of playing again this season.

Possible return date: May.

What Arteta has said: "Well he's another one who is going to push every boundary. He's doing a lot of exercises already.

"He reacted well to the surgery and he has no pain. I am sure there is a chance to make that period shorter."
